There is no way to make the alveolar bone grow fast after tooth extraction, you can help the alveolar bone recovery by filling collagen or centrifugal growth factors from your own blood to prevent resorption of the alveolar bone after tooth extraction.
1. Collagen: After tooth extraction, collagen can be used to insert into the alveolar fossa, which has good biocompatibility and can be absorbed without removing, helping to stop bleeding in the alveolar fossa, preserving the width of the fossa, and preventing resorption of the alveolar fossa after tooth extraction.
2. Cell growth factor: you can extract your own blood, centrifuge high-speed centrifugal separation, extraction of cell growth factor, fibrin and other components of your own blood, into the alveolar socket, effectively promote the absorption of inflammation, reduce postoperative symptoms, and promote bone formation.
After tooth extraction can not promote the rapid growth of alveolar bone, but can be filled with collagen, cell growth factor and other biomaterials, to promote the formation of new bone, to prevent excessive resorption of alveolar bone has a positive effect, the use of these means is recommended to professional hospitals.
